| IP Address | Location, Date & Time |
| 66.220.149.4 |
United States, California, Menlo Park, 94025 at 14:30:08 Feb/16/2026
|
| 66.220.149.39 |
United States, California, Menlo Park, 94025 at 14:30:07 Feb/16/2026
|